Management Meeting Minutes — Branch Managers

Attendees: T. Vasek, R. Olander, P. Minn.

1. Loyalty overhaul approved. Current Bramblepoint Rewards scheme retired end of quarter.
2. New tiered model launches at all branches simultaneously; no pilots.
3. Point balances migrate 1:1. Staff training packs issue next week.
4. Marketing handles customer comms; branches field queries only.
5. Budget impact covered centrally.

Further commercial rationale is recorded in the confidential note below.

management briefing: The pricing group signed off on a budget of $378.8 million for Project Kasael.

Hi team,

Quick heads-up on the Tollgate rules engine integration for shipping fees. The evaluate endpoint now enforces auth on every call — no more anonymous sandbox mode, which I know the security review flagged. Rate calculations are unchanged; only the handshake differs. Please rerun your fee-matrix tests against the Quillford staging cluster this week. The sandbox credential you'll need is just below.

session JWT of yawep-yawep = eyJhbGciOiJIUzI1NiIsInR5cCI6IkpXVCJ9.eyJzdWIiOiI3pWF3_In0.aXYsHiog

**Vendor note: Inkmill markdown pipeline**

Rendering for Parchway docs is outsourced to Inkmill under an annual contract, renewing each March. They handle sanitization and PDF export; we own the upload queue. SLA: 4-hour response on rendering failures. Escalate only after two failed retries. Their support desk is reachable at the address below.

billing contact of hahaf-baguf = zorael.tammir.jorius@sivrelhq.internal